基于载波调制的光纤通信网络传输质量提升方法  被引量:7

A method for improving transmission quality of optical fiber communication network based on carrier modulation

摘  要:光纤通信网络传输信道畸变,影响了光纤通信网络传输质量,为此,提出了基于载波调制的光纤通信网络传输质量提升方法。构建光纤通信网络传输的传输大数据采集和特征分析模型,结合模糊聚类方法进行光纤通信网络输出信道的扩频处理,采用载波调制方法进行光纤通信网络的波特均衡控制,抑制光纤通信网络传输信道畸变,优化光纤通信网络传输质量。结果表明,采用该方法进行光纤通信网络传输精度可达96.2%,网络信道均衡性较好,输出误码率较低,在16 dB和13 dB时可达最低误码率,有效提升了光纤通信网络传输质量。The transmission channel distortion of optical fiber communication network affects the transmission quality of optical fiber communication network.Therefore,a method to improve the transmission quality of optical fiber communication network based on carrier modulation is proposed.The transmission big data acquisition and characteristic analysis model of optical fiber communication network transmission is constructed.Combined with the fuzzy clustering method,the spread spectrum processing of the output channel of optical fiber communication network is carried out.The carrier modulation method is used for baud equalization control of optical fiber communication network,so as to suppress the transmission channel distortion of optical fiber communication network and optimize the transmission quality of optical fiber communication network.The results show that the transmission accuracy of optical fiber communication network using this method can reach 96.2%,the network channel balance is good,the output bit error rate is low,and the lowest bit error rate can be reached at 16 dB and 13 dB,which effectively improves the transmission quality of optical fiber communication network.

关 键 词:光纤通信网络 载波调制 扩频处理 信道均衡性 传输质量
